ATTITUDE Dishwasher Pods Unscented

A simplified, plant-based detergent utilizing a blend of coconut-derived surfactants to cut grease without the use of harsh enzymes or bleaching agents.

Performance Rating: 1.0

This ingredient list is highly unusual for an automatic dishwasher detergent and appears to be a formulation for hand dish soap. Dishwashers require low-foaming surfactants and rely on enzymes (protease, amylase) and builders (citrates, carbonates) to break down food and soften water. The ingredients listed here—specifically Sodium Coco-Sulfate—are high-foaming anionic surfactants. Using this in a dishwasher would likely cause excessive sudsing (foam overflow), pump cavitation, and very poor cleaning results on dried-on food due to the lack of enzymes and bleaching agents.

Safety Rating: 4.7

From a health and environmental perspective, the ingredients are excellent. They are plant-derived, biodegradable, and mild. The formulation avoids harsh chemicals typically found in dishwasher detergents, such as phosphates, chlorine bleach, and synthetic fragrances. It is hypoallergenic and safe for gray water systems.

Final Rating: 1.8

While the product receives a near-perfect score for ingredient safety and eco-friendliness, it is fundamentally ill-suited for the stated purpose of an automatic dishwasher pod. The formulation lacks the necessary chemical energy (alkalinity, enzymes) to clean effectively in a machine and poses a risk of damaging the appliance due to high foam generation. Ideally, this formula should be used for hand washing dishes, where it would perform well.

Verdict

The formulation provided represents a radical departure from conventional automatic dishwashing detergents. Most standard pods are a chemical cocktail of enzymes, bleaching agents, anti-redeposition polymers, and chelators. In stark contrast, this product relies entirely on a blend of anionic and non-ionic surfactants. The primary cleaning agent, Sodium Coco-Sulfate, is a coconut-derived alternative to harsher sulfates, providing the necessary foaming and grease-cutting action. This is supported by a trio of glucosides: Lauryl Glucoside, Myristyl Glucoside, and Caprylyl Glucoside. These are sugar-derived, biodegradable surfactants known for their mildness and ability to break down surface oils. The sheer simplicity of this ingredient list is commendable for those seeking a truly natural and non-toxic cleaning solution. There are no artificial fragrances, dyes, or harsh preservatives listed, making it an excellent choice for households with chemical sensitivities or those strictly avoiding synthetic additives. However, from a performance standpoint, users should manage their expectations. Modern dishwashers rely heavily on enzymes (like protease and amylase) to digest stuck-on food particles such as dried egg or oatmeal. Without these enzymatic cleaners or oxidative bleaches, this pod may struggle with baked-on residues or heavy staining from tea and coffee. The surfactants will excel at washing away fresh grease and oil, but mechanical scraping or pre-rinsing will likely be necessary for dirty loads. Furthermore, the lack of water softeners or chelating agents suggests that this product may leave water spots or mineral deposits in areas with hard water, necessitating the use of a separate rinse aid. In summary, this is a highly eco-conscious product that prioritizes safety and environmental impact over aggressive cleaning power. It is ideal for light daily loads but may require extra manual effort for heavily soiled cookware.

Ingredient Evaluation

📁 Surfactants & Cleaning Agents / 表面活性剂与清洁成分

🧪 Sodium Coco-Sulfate / 椰油醇硫酸酯钠

Purpose: Anionic surfactant responsible for removing grease, dirt, and food particles.

Concerns: Generally considered safer than SLS (Sodium Lauryl Sulfate), but can still be a skin irritant in high concentrations (less concern for dishwasher pods as they are not applied to skin).

Notes: Derived from coconut oil, it is a blend of fatty acids rather than a single isolated chain.

🧪 Lauryl Glucoside / 月桂基葡糖苷

Purpose: Non-ionic surfactant that helps lift dirt and oils; acts as a mild detergent.

Concerns: Considered very safe and mild; low risk of irritation.

Notes: Biodegradable ingredient derived from plant sugars and fatty alcohols.

🧪 Myristyl Glucoside / 肉豆蔻基葡糖苷

Purpose: Surfactant used for its cleansing properties and ability to stabilize foam/emulsions.

Concerns: No significant concerns; generally recognized as safe.

Notes: Often used in combination with other glucosides to enhance cleaning performance.

🧪 Caprylyl Glucoside / 辛基葡糖苷

Purpose: Surfactant and solubilizer that helps mix oil and water; assists in cleaning efficiency.

Concerns: Very low concern; known for being mild and gentle.

Notes: Effective in high pH environments often found in dishwashing.
